✅ 1. Set Clear, Measurable Goals

Without clear goals, you’re sailing without a compass. Every successful person has a career roadmap—even if it's informal. The trick is to break long-term dreams into small, achievable steps:

  • 🎯 Set SMART goals: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ound
  • 📝 Write down your monthly goals in a journal or app like Notion or Trello
  • 📊 Track your wins weekly to measure progress

For example, instead of saying “I want a promotion,” say: “I will lead one major project and complete a certification within 3 months.” Goal setting increases focus and gives purpose to your actions.

✅ 2. Prioritize Continuous Learning

In every industry, skills expire quickly. The professionals who grow fastest invest in learning—continuously. Whether it's a new programming language, a leadership course, or better Excel skills, the habit of daily learning pays lifelong dividends.

  • 📚 Read 15–30 minutes daily (books, blogs, or newsletters)
  • 🎓 Take 1 course every quarter (Coursera, Udemy, LinkedIn Learning)
  • 🧠 Join communities like Reddit, Slack groups, or industry-specific forums

Learning expands your mind and keeps you future-ready. It shows employers that you’re proactive and serious about your growth.

✅ 3. Build a Powerful Professional Network

It's not just what you know—it’s also who you know. Networking helps you discover hidden job opportunities, mentors, and collaborations. But effective networking isn’t just sending cold DMs on LinkedIn. It's about building real connections.

  • 🤝 Attend at least 1 virtual or in-person industry event per month
  • 💬 Engage meaningfully on LinkedIn (comment, share, message thoughtfully)
  • 🌱 Offer value: Share knowledge, connect people, or provide help

Networking is a habit. Make time weekly—even 15 minutes—to nurture connections. The results compound over time.

✅ 4. Develop a Strong Personal Brand

In today’s digital world, your online presence is your new resume. A clear personal brand makes recruiters, clients, and peers trust your expertise before ever meeting you.

To build your brand:

  • 🔗 Optimize your LinkedIn headline and summary
  • 📝 Post or write regularly about your niche
  • 🎯 Create a professional portfolio site if relevant

Your brand should answer: “What do I want to be known for?” Are you the go-to person for automation, branding, or strategy? Own it and show it consistently.

✅ 5. Practice Self-Discipline and Consistency

Discipline is the hidden engine of career success. The habit of doing high-value tasks—even when you don’t feel like it—sets top performers apart. Consistency in effort beats bursts of motivation.

  • ⏰ Set daily routines: Start with a morning plan or task list
  • 📵 Limit distractions: Turn off notifications during focus time
  • 💡 Use productivity techniques like Pomodoro or time blocking

Remember, success isn’t made in a day—it’s made daily. Build your work ethic like a muscle: steady, focused, and intentional.
